第十章 Springboot+ Shiro +Jwt前后端分离鉴权

1、前后端分离会话问题

【1】问题追踪

前面我们实现分布式的会话缓存,但是我们发现此功能的实现是基于浏览的cookie机制,也就是说用户禁用cookie后,我们的系统会就会产生会话不同的问题

【2】解决方案

​ 我们的前端可能是web、Android、ios等应用,同时我们每一个接口都提供了无状态的应答方式,这里我们提供了基于JWT的token生成方案

 1、用户登陆之后,获得此时会话的sessionId,使用JWT根据sessionId颁发签名并设置过期时间(与session过期时间相同)返回token

2、将token保存到客户端本地,并且每次发送请求时都在 header 上携带JwtToken

3、ShiroSessionManager继承DefaultWebSessionManager,重写getSessionId方法,从header上检测是否携带JwtToken,如果携带,则进行解码JwtToken,使用JwtToken中的jti作为SessionId。

4、重写shiro的默认 过滤器 ,使其支持jwtToken有效期校验、及对JSON的返回支持
    JwtAuthc filter :实现是否需要登录的过滤,拒绝时如果header上携带JwtToken,则返回对应json
    JwtPermsFilter:实现是否有对应资源的过滤,拒绝时如果header上携带JwtToken,则返回对应json
    JwtRolesFilter:实现是否有对应角色的过滤,拒绝时如果header上携带JwtToken,则返回对应json  

2、JWT概述

JWT(JSON WEB TOKEN):JSON网络令牌,JWT是一个轻便的安全跨平台传输格式,定义了一个紧凑的自包含的方式在不同实体之间安全传输信息(JSON格式)。它是在Web环境下两个实体之间传输数据的一项标准。实际上传输的就是一个 字符串

  • 广义上:JWT是一个标准的名称;
  • 狭义上:JWT指的就是用来传递的那个token字符串

JWT由三部分构成:header(头部)、payload(载荷)和signature(签名)。

  1. Header

存储两个变量

  1. 秘钥(可以用来比对)
  2. 算法(也就是下面将Header和payload加密成Signature)
  3. payload

存储很多东西,基础信息有如下几个

  1. 签发人,也就是这个“令牌”归属于哪个用户。一般是userId
  2. 创建时间,也就是这个令牌是什么时候创建的
  3. 失效时间,也就是这个令牌什么时候失效(session的失效时间)
  4. 唯一标识,一般可以使用算法生成一个唯一标识(jti==>sessionId)
  5. Signature

这个是上面两个经过Header中的算法加密生成的,用于比对信息,防止篡改Header和payload

然后将这三个部分的信息经过加密生成一个JwtToken的字符串,发送给客户端,客户端保存在本地。当客户端发起请求的时候携带这个到服务端(可以是在cookie,可以是在header),在服务端进行验证,我们需要解密对于的payload的内容

4、重写DefaultWebSessionManager

ShiroSessionManager主要是添加jwtToken的jti作为会话的唯一标识

 package com.itheima.shiro.core.impl;

import com.itheima.shiro.utils.EmptyUtil;
import io.jsonwebtoken.Claims;
import org. apache .shiro.web. servlet .ShiroHttpServletRequest;
import org.apache.shiro.web.session.mgt.DefaultWebSessionManager;
import org.apache.shiro.web.util.WebUtils;
import org.springframework.beans.factory.annotation.Autowired;

import javax.servlet.ServletRequest;
import javax.servlet.ServletResponse;
import java.io.Serializable;

/**
 * @Description 重写Jwt会话管理
 */

public class ShiroSessionManager extends DefaultWebSessionManager {

    private static final String AUTHORIZATION = "jwtToken";

    private static final String REFERENCED_SESSION_ID_SOURCE = "Stateless request";

    public ShiroSessionManager(){
        super();
    }

    @Autowired
    JwtTokenManager jwtTokenManager;

    @ Override 
    protected Serializable getSessionId(ServletRequest request, ServletResponse response){
        String jwtToken = WebUtils.toHttp(request).getHeader(AUTHORIZATION);
        if(EmptyUtil.isNullOrEmpty(jwtToken)){
            //如果没有携带id参数则按照父类的方式在cookie进行获取
            return super.getSessionId(request, response);
        }else{
            //如果请求头中有 authToken 则其值为jwtToken,然后解析出会话session
            request.setAttribute(ShiroHttpServletRequest.REFERENCED_SESSION_ID_SOURCE,REFERENCED_SESSION_ID_SOURCE);
            Claims decode = jwtTokenManager.decodeToken(jwtToken);
            String id = (String) decode.get("jti");
            request.setAttribute(ShiroHttpServletRequest.REFERENCED_SESSION_ID,id);
            request.setAttribute(ShiroHttpServletRequest.REFERENCED_SESSION_ID_IS_VALID,Boolean.TRUE);
            return id;
        }
    }

}

【1】JwtAuthcFilter

使用wtTokenManager.isVerifyToken(jwtToken)校验颁发jwtToken是否合法,同时在拒绝的时候返回对应的json数据格式

 package com.itheima.shiro.core.filter;

import com.alibaba. fastjson .JSONObject;
import com.itheima.shiro.constant.ShiroConstant;
import com.itheima.shiro.core.base.BaseResponse;
import com.itheima.shiro.core.impl.JwtTokenManager;
import com.itheima.shiro.core.impl.ShiroSessionManager;
import com.itheima.shiro.utils.EmptyUtil;
import org.apache.shiro.web.filter.authc.FormAuthenticationFilter;
import org.apache.shiro.web.util.WebUtils;

import javax.servlet.ServletRequest;
import javax.servlet.ServletResponse;

/**
 * @Description:自定义登录验证过滤器
 */
public class JwtAuthcFilter extends FormAuthenticationFilter {

    private JwtTokenManager jwtTokenManager;

    public JwtAuthcFilter(JwtTokenManager jwtTokenManager) {
        this.jwtTokenManager = jwtTokenManager;
    }

    /**
     * @Description 是否允许访问
     */
    @Override
    protected boolean isAccessAllowed(ServletRequest request, ServletResponse response, Object mappedValue) {
        //判断当前请求头中是否带有jwtToken的字符串
        String jwtToken = WebUtils.toHttp(request).getHeader("jwtToken");
        //如果有:走jwt校验
        if (!EmptyUtil.isNullOrEmpty(jwtToken)){
            boolean verifyToken = jwtTokenManager.isVerifyToken(jwtToken);
            if (verifyToken){
                return super.isAccessAllowed(request, response, mappedValue);
            }else {
                return false;
            }
        }
        //没有没有:走原始校验
        return super.isAccessAllowed(request, response, mappedValue);
    }

    /**
     * @Description 访问拒绝时调用
     */
    @Override
    protected boolean onAccessDenied(ServletRequest request, ServletResponse response) throws Exception {
        //判断当前请求头中是否带有jwtToken的字符串
        String jwtToken = WebUtils.toHttp(request).getHeader("jwtToken");
        //如果有:返回json的应答
        if (!EmptyUtil.isNullOrEmpty(jwtToken)){
            BaseResponse baseResponse = new BaseResponse(ShiroConstant.NO_LOGIN_CODE,ShiroConstant.NO_LOGIN_MESSAGE);
            response.setCharacterEncoding("UTF-8");
            response.setContentType("application/json; charset=utf-8");
            response.getWriter().write(JSONObject.toJSONString(baseResponse));
            return false;
        }
        //如果没有:走原始方式
        return super.onAccessDenied(request, response);
    }
}
